| 원본 입력 | MD5-32 | MD5-16 | MD5-32 대문자 |
|---|
128비트 다이제스트를 생성하고 이를 32 소문자 16진수 문자로 표시합니다. 파일 무결성 검사, 데이터 지문 및 중복 제거에 널리 사용됩니다. 예: 5d41402abc4b2a76b9719d911017c592
9–24 문자를 가져와 중간 64비트를 효과적으로 노출합니다. 더 짧지만 충돌 위험이 더 높습니다(약 2⁻⁶⁴ ). 보안 수준이 낮은 시나리오의 짧은 ID 또는 토큰에 적합하지만 보안 유효성 검사에는 권장되지 않습니다.
A–F )입니다. 일부 레거시 시스템, 결제 서명 또는 엔터프라이즈 인터페이스에는 대문자 출력이 필요합니다. 예: 5D41402ABC4B2A76B9719D911017C592
UTF-8 인코딩된 문자열로 처리하고 해싱 전에 중국어, 일본어 또는 이모티콘과 같은 멀티바이트 문자를 바이트 시퀀스로 자동 변환합니다. 이는 가장 일반적인 모드이며 일반 텍스트 입력에 작동합니다.
0-9, a-f , 공백은 무시됨)로 처리합니다. 해싱 전에 두 문자마다 1바이트로 구문 분석됩니다. 이는 키나 프로토콜 페이로드와 같은 원시 바이너리 데이터를 해싱할 때 유용합니다. 입력 예: 48 65 6c 6c 6f
Base64 문자열로 처리하고 이를 원시 바이트로 디코딩한 후 해당 바이트를 해시합니다. Base64에 표시된 파일 또는 이미지 콘텐츠의 원본 해시를 계산할 때 유용합니다. 예: SGVsbG8=
\n 을 구분 기호로 사용하여 입력을 여러 줄로 분할하고 각 줄을 독립적으로 해시합니다. 빈 줄은 자동으로 무시됩니다. 기본 출력에는 한 줄에 하나의 해시가 표시되며 아래 전체 배치 테이블에는 MD5-32, MD5-16 및 원클릭 CSV 내보내기가 가능한 대문자 결과가 포함됩니다. 사용자 이름, 비밀번호 목록 및 데이터 세트 처리에 유용합니다.